Common Issues and Causes for Repair

The Mercedes Comfort Access system, designed to offer a seamless entry experience for drivers and passengers, can encounter various issues over time. Common problems include malfunctioning keyless entry fobs, delayed or failed door unlocking, and difficulty in starting the vehicle. These issues often stem from several factors.
Electrical faults, such as worn-out or damaged wiring within the door panels or control module, are a leading cause. Corrosion or loose connections can disrupt the system’s functionality. Moreover, physical damage to the car body repair areas around the door handles and sensors can also trigger Mercedes comfort access repair needs. Vehicle paint repair might be required if the issue is caused by cosmetic damage affecting the sensors’ alignment. Step-by-Step Guide to Door Repair Process

Repairs for Mercedes Comfort Access systems can be a complex process that requires specialized knowledge and tools. If you’re planning to fix your Mercedes driver or passenger doors, here’s a simplified step-by-step guide to help you get started:
1. Safety First: Before beginning any repair work, ensure the vehicle is parked on a level surface with parking brakes engaged. Turn off the ignition and allow all electrical systems to power down completely for safety reasons. Protect yourself by wearing appropriate work gloves to handle any sharp edges or debris.
2. Disassemble the Door Panel: Carefully remove the door panel to access the interior components, including the comfort access system. This may involve detaching electrical wiring harness connectors using specialized tools. Take note of where each wire connects for easy reassembly later. Once disconnected, carefully lift out the old door panel, setting aside any reusable parts or hardware.
3. Inspect and Replace Worn Components: Examine the interior components, looking for any damaged or faulty parts within the comfort access system. Common issues may include worn-out plastic parts, damaged sensors, or malfunctioning actuators. Replace these components with genuine Mercedes-Benz spare parts to ensure proper functionality.
4. Reassemble and Test: After replacing any faulty parts, carefully reassemble the door panel, ensuring all wiring connectors are properly seated. Double-check for secure fastenings. Once assembled, power on the vehicle and test the door’s locking and unlocking mechanisms, as well as any associated features like window operation, to ensure everything functions correctly.
